Most rice terraces look more charming when the landscape is green; Yuanyang however are more frequently visited after harvest, in winter, when the terraces are mirror pools.
Visited Yuanyang in August of 2013, just months after being inscribed in the World Heritage List. At the time, transportation from one rice terrace cluster to another was difficult. My friend and I rode the local small buses with the locals; rides were irregular and less frequent. We found out that transportation will become more "centralized," using new fancy buses, to accommodate the tourists expected to pour in, especially after the World Heritage inscription. Cases like this, the local authorities will not only dictate price, they also squeeze out local car owners who benefit from driving tourists.
